A Ubix temporary roof for Edinburgh’s High Court of Justiciary

19 Jan 12 The Ubix temporary roof system, from Combisafe International, has kept the Grade A listed High Court of Justiciary building in Edinburgh wind and watertight during the six month project to remove and replace its glazed atrium roof.

Following a history of leaks and breakages, as well as thermal insulation issues and excessive heat gain, a project was put in place to replace the High Court’s atrium roof with a solid insulated roof. Main contractor Robertson Construction and specialist scaffolding and temporay roofing contractor Interserve Industrial Services Ltd had to ensure that any construction works would have a minimal impact on staff, customers and the public.

The Ubix temporary roof system delivers outstanding on-site weather protection and requires no specialist tools or lifting gear. This means it can be managed at height by a relatively small team, as components are light and all parts snap together for a rapid assembly process. At just 8kg per square metre it’s the lightest temporary roofing solution on the market, making it ideal for this project.

As it was the first time Interserve had used the Ubix system, the company’s team of ten operatives attended a Ubix installation training session. Following this training, the Interserve team successfully completed the installation of a 49m x 31m roof in just four working days to ensure the refurbishment programme remained on schedule and on budget.

Protecting an area measuring 1519m2, equal to the full building plan, the Ubix temporary roof was supported from street level by the erection of scaffolding on the building’s east and west elevations, all of which remained in place throughout the six month programme most of which was through the autumn and winter months. There was no rainwater ingress through the roof at any time.
